WebIn addition to shingle bond and fastening, you should check for any problems related to the shingles' manufacture, installation, appearance and design, and damage or deterioration … WebJul 11, 2001 · I just got chastised for doing the brittle test on a roof that did not have any damage. The brittle test failed and the shingle broke. The only damage to the roof was by me doing the stupid brittle test. I am keeping a log of the many different changes in the way I am told to fill out the paper work. Every storm is different.

WebLike 4 or 5 sections where the shingles have been blown clean off. Went and did a brittle test and it failed horribly. Gotta set up a video call now to demonstrate that these shingles are unrepairable. We have a one square rule where I live and it's been a slough to get them to total the roof. HorizontalHeight
